Right at number 3 it gets difficult, because without some extremely believable propaganda supporting an ideology which requires this imprisonment/harassment of the general population for some reason. In the USA this would be difficult because the military is volunteer and our economy is not absolutely hopeless. It would be difficult to find enough people motivated to do such a thing.
The other problem is who does this benefit? Having your population imprisoned doesn't make the government more powerful, it takes away valuable members of the workforce and creates civil unrest. If it wasn't safe for you to leave your home because of either rioters or government thugs, commerce would shut down. Tax revenue would grind to a halt.
A dictator who tried by your method would soon become a prison warden, charged with either killing or feeding an entire nation without the benefit of tax revenue.

The easier path to tyranny is to couch all of your new laws with some reason why it would be cruel not to pass the legislation. You can ban smoking because children breathe air, you can ban freedom of association because of some tiny minority of pedophiles exchanging photos, you can remove free speech because some people say ugly things.
If you do it slowly enough, each measure will seem to make sense, and it will have more firmly established legal precedents.
